Assimp는 Open Asset Import Library의 약자로, fbx, obj, gltf 등 다양한 3d 모델 포맷을 지원한다. OpenGL 프로그램에서 모델링 불러올 때는 웬만하면 이걸 사용하는 것 같다.학교 수업에서도 사용했고, learnopengl.com에서도 이걸 소개하고 있다. 우선 얘가 사용하는 구조를 보자면 다음과 같다. 이 다이어그램 전체가 하나의 모델이라고 생각하면 된다.언뜻 보기에는 좀 복잡한데, 천천히 살펴보자면우선 중요한 점을 하나 짚고 가자면, 모델은 여러개의 메시로 이루어져있다.모델의 모든 데이터는 Scene 안에 담겨있다. (material, mesh 등)좌측을 보면 Scene에 Root node가 달려있고, 그 아래로 트리처럼 Child node들이 달려있는 것을 ..